About Madurai City

Madurai the oldest city of India. Thou Chennai is the capital of Tamil Nadu, Madurai clams to be the soul. Rich is Dravidian culture Tamil rooted its skyline is dominated by the 14 colourful gopurams (gateway towers) of Meenakshi Amman Temple. Covered in bright carvings of Hindu gods, the Dravidian-style temple is a major pilgrimage site. The place has a great cultural heritage and strong mythological history to be passed on to the coming generations. The reason most people visit the city is the Meenakshi Temple, dedicated to the goddess Meenakshi with a sanctum for her consort, Sundareshwarar.

Nice to know - constructed in the form of a lotus and is known as Lotus city.

About Khajuraho City

The Khajuraho Group of Monuments is a group of Hindu and Jain temples in Madhya Pradesh, India. Stunning temples adorned by erotic and sensuous carvings. Khajuraho is a brilliant example of Indian architecture and its culture back in the medieval period. The architecture of these Hindu and Jain temples depict the innocent form of love, the carvings on the walls display passion in the most erotic yet aesthetic ways. Built between 950 to 1050 AD the sheer confrontational nature of these carvings show a stark paradox with the conventional Indian ideals about eroticism, leaving everybody spellbound lovely stone friezes of gods, goddesses, heroes and kings, concubines, and many more would hail you as you journey to Khajuraho.

Above all, it reflects a unique architectural talent which depicts royalty, courtship, marriage, spiritual teachings, meditation, kinship and intimate scenes of human emotions and relationships. You may also enjoy watching the folk dances, light and sound shows, organized in the temple premises and other art centers.

Nice to know
Khajuraho is the UNESCO World Heritage Site. The erotic and other carvings that swathe Khajuraho’s three groups of World Heritage–listed temples are among the finest temple art in the world.

Best time to visit

Jul-Mar is the best time to visit Khajuraho. Winter season is the best season for a visit to Khajuraho, especially in the context of the outdoor activities. The months when Khajuraho is ideal for a trip is between October - March. Monsoons are also nice for a visit to the same, although the rainfall might dampen your trip plans. The summers, though, are the least advisable time for a visit, owing to the scorching heat and the unbearable humidity.
